WebGhostly visage was a protective illusion spell cast by bards, sorcerers, and wizards. The spell created a nimbus of ghostly light around the caster. The ghostly nimbus created by this spell protected the caster in various ways. It canceled the effects of any spell that was less powerful than ghostly visage, as well as making the caster harder to hit.
